Well I'd be quite happy with (the perfect setup :D):
- purchase/gift credits bundles (for volume pricing)
- option to purchase first, register next
- multiple purchase option
- use different currencies (with optional exchange)
- credits for forum activity (already extensively discussed)
- trophy criterias integration
- credits for trophies (per usergroup)
- credits for birthday
- salary option (per usergroup)
- credits for referrals (per usergroup)
- credits when referrals purchase credits :X3: (in fixed price or percentage per item and/or usergoup -- but that would be more for the shop addon)
- interests, either fixed amount or percentage (with minimal and maximal balance for interests)
- display option (link or balance) on registered users' navigation bar
- resources and user upgrades purchase/gift integration
- credits to enter usergroups (but isn't that like purchasing user upgrades with credits?)
- PayPal alternative(s) like Stripe, or [bd]paygate support
- all in one solution, active support, business integrity :whistle:
- pricing and branding removal (way) under $500 :p

I know several were already listed but see it more as my vote for these features :)
